Introduction
This article will show how to provide access to your users so they can start utilizing an array of tools inside panalitix.com. There are two ways that you can add a new User to your Account:
Inviting a New User
This is where the new Person does not exist in your Contacts and you would like to create a brand new User Account for them to log into.
- As the Account Administrator, click on My Users.
- Click on Invite New User.
- Enter their First Name, Last Name and Email Address.
- Then select which modules that you would like this new User to have access to. ex. Learning Hub, Marketing Hub, etc.
- Then select what level of access that this new User should have. There are two options Member User or Member Administrator.
- Click Invite. This will then send the new User an invitation to their email.
- The User can then check their email inbox for their new Account access and Login details.
Adding an Existing Contact
This is where a Person already exists in your Contacts, either in your Business or in another Organization.

- As the Account Administrator, click on My Users.
- Click on Add Existing Contact.
- Select the tab for either your Business name or Other Contacts.
- If selecting from your Business name, select the Person that appears in the list and tick the box next to their name.
- If selecting from Other Contacts, search for the Person's name in the search box until it appears and select their name.
- Then select which modules that you would like this new User to have access to.
- Then select what level of access that this new User should have. There are two options Member User or Member Administrator.
- Click Invite. This will then send the new User an invitation to their email address that is recorded against their Contact details.
- The User can then check their email inbox for their new Account access and Login details.
